The question that Paul set before the ancient church in Corinth - Do you not
recognize that Jesus Christ is in and among you? (2 Cor 13:5) ù remains a
critical question for the church today. This commentary by Mark Seifrid offers
a unified reading of 2 Corinthians, which has often been regarded as a
composite of excerpts and fragments, as Seifrid seeks to hear Paul's message
afresh and communicate it to our time. (= 9780802837394)

Mark Seifrid takes a distinctive approach to the commentator's task: " rather than cataloging and evaluating the opinions of modern scholars, he
chooses to focus on his own fresh, stimulating, and very definite
interpretation of the letter, its theology, and its significance for
fundamental issues of hermeneutics. - Douglas J. Moo"

Seifrid brings extraordinary erudition, exegetical precision, and astute " theological reflection to the interpretation of this poignant letter. He makes
Paul's parental love for his problem church come alive and presents his word of
the cross so that it also speaks to present-day realities. . . . An outstanding
addition to an excellent commentary series. - David E. Garland"

Series: Pillar New Testament Commentary.
